I have coins in a new wallet created in Trezor Suite, linked to a Trezor device. I keep my recovery phrases in a safe place. Would it be possible to buy a scond Trezor and use it with the same wallet, managing it with the same Trezor Suite? If so, how? The idea is, that if my existing Trezor device gets damaged (I fundamentally distrust all hardware
), I would not even need to use the recovery phrase, but could simply continue using the other device - that “holds the same coins” (i.e. the same keys as the first device).

Yes, this is absolutely possible.
If you purchase a second Trezor device and recover it using the same wallet backup (recovery seed) as your first device, both devices will mirror the same wallet.
You’ll need to go through the recovery process on the second device initially, but once that’s completed, both devices will hold the exact same wallet. This means you can manage a single wallet using two devices interchangeably.
Having a backup device is a great idea as it provides additional peace of mind in case one device stops working unexpectedly ![]()
